Skip to content

auth-center-frontend

  • Vue 2.6.10
  • Jenkins build

项目介绍

小说项目-用户应用中心

bash
Tips: 与机器猫的用户中心同仓库,只用分支(novel分支)做隔离,novel分已加入保护分支

说明

bash
# 克隆项目
git clone http://39.108.189.115:81/novel/frontend/novel-ui.git

# 进入项目目录
cd novel-ui

# 安装依赖 (node is 16.14.2)
pnpm install

# 启动服务
npm run dev

发布

npm
bash
# 构建测试环境
npm run test

# 构建生产环境
npm run build:prod

Jenkins job

shell.jenkins
shell
#!/bin/bash

export NODEJS16_HOME=/opt/nodejs/node-v16.14.2
export PATH=$NODEJS16_HOME/bin:$PATH

npm install
npm run test

cd dist/
ls -l
rm -f html.tar
tar zcvf html.tar *